VCU crushes Richmond, awaits George Washington

March 14, 2014 by Joe Mags Leave a Comment

  Rebounding, forced turnovers are key stat categories in Rams victory over Spiders By: Joe Manganiello BROOKLYN, N.Y. -- From beginning to end, Virginia Commonwealth dominated Richmond, winning 71-53 by capitalizing on turnovers and controlling the glass. VCU out-rebounded the Spiders 50-28, and forced 14 turnovers. The rebounding was a particular emphasis … [Read more...] about VCU crushes Richmond, awaits George Washington
